Understanding Common Issues with Ocx Files

An OCX file, utilized as a component or control file by ActiveX forms in Microsoft applications, is typically useful. However, users might encounter a range of issues when managing OCX files. Let's delve into some of the common problems:

  • Compatibility Concerns: If an OCX file is tailored for a particular version of an application or Windows, it might not work as intended with different versions. This could lead to functional problems or a complete inability of the component to load.
  • Clashes Arising from OCX Files: If multiple instances of an OCX file are present on a system, it can instigate conflicts that lead to errors or make the applications that depend on the file unstable.
  • Security Hazards: Since OCX files can encompass executable code, they can constitute a security risk if they originate from dubious developers or websites. They may harbor malicious code that could undermine a user's system.
  • Missing OCX File Errors: If an OCX file is missing from its designated location, applications that rely on it may fail to run or display errors. This often happens if the file was accidentally deleted or moved.
  • Registration Problems: OCX files need to be registered in the Windows registry to function properly. If registration fails, it may lead to errors when the associated application attempts to use the file.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the cmll15fx.ocx problem persists.
